Understanding Binaural Beats

Binaural beats are an auditory illusion created when two slightly different frequencies are played in each ear. For example, if a 200 Hz tone is played in the left ear and a 210 Hz tone in the right ear, the brain perceives a third tone at the difference of the two frequencies—in this case, 10 Hz. This perceived tone is called a binaural beat.

The fascinating aspect of binaural beats lies in their ability to influence brainwave activity. Different brainwave frequencies correspond to different mental states:

  • Delta Waves (0.5–4 Hz): Deep sleep and restorative processes
  • Theta Waves (4–8 Hz): Deep relaxation, meditation, creativity
  • Alpha Waves (8–14 Hz): Calmness, focus, light relaxation
  • Beta Waves (14–30 Hz): Active thinking, concentration, alertness
  • Gamma Waves (30–100 Hz): Higher mental activity, perception, problem-solving

By listening to binaural beats at specific frequencies, individuals can theoretically guide their brainwaves toward a desired state, such as relaxation or focus, offering a novel tool for stress management.

How Binaural Beats Influence Stress

Stress triggers the body’s fight-or-flight response, releasing cortisol and adrenaline, which can lead to anxiety, tension, and impaired cognitive function. Binaural beats work by stimulating the brain to shift from high-frequency beta waves, associated with stress and overthinking, to lower-frequency alpha or theta waves, associated with relaxation and calmness.

Several mechanisms explain this effect:

  1. Brainwave Entrainment: The brain naturally synchronizes with the frequency of the binaural beat, promoting a shift to a more relaxed mental state.
  2. Neurochemical Modulation: Listening to calming frequencies may increase the production of dopamine and serotonin, neurotransmitters that enhance mood and reduce stress.
  3. Enhanced Mindfulness and Meditation: Binaural beats can facilitate deeper meditation by helping individuals maintain focus, making it easier to detach from stressors.

Scientific Evidence Supporting Binaural Beats

While research is still emerging, multiple studies suggest that binaural beats can have measurable effects on stress and mental well-being:

  • A 2018 study in Frontiers in Human Neuroscience found that participants listening to theta-frequency binaural beats experienced significantly lower levels of perceived stress and anxiety compared to control groups.
  • Research in the Journal of Alternative and Complementary Medicine (2019) demonstrated that binaural beats improved mood, decreased anxiety, and enhanced cognitive performance in a group of adults under stressful conditions.
  • A 2020 meta-analysis concluded that binaural beats could positively influence physiological markers of stress, such as heart rate and blood pressure, although individual responses varied.

These findings suggest that binaural beats can be a complementary tool for stress management, though they are not a replacement for professional care in cases of chronic anxiety or depression.

Benefits of Using Binaural Beats for Stress Relief

Binaural beats offer several advantages that make them appealing for modern stress management:

1. Accessibility and Convenience

All that is needed is a pair of stereo headphones and an audio source. Binaural beats can be integrated into daily routines—during commutes, lunch breaks, or before sleep—without disrupting other activities.

2. Non-Invasive and Drug-Free

Unlike medications or supplements, binaural beats are a natural, non-invasive method for reducing stress, with minimal risk of side effects.

3. Enhances Other Relaxation Practices

Combining binaural beats with meditation, yoga, or deep breathing can deepen relaxation, making it easier to achieve desired mental states.

4. Supports Cognitive Function and Focus

Beyond stress reduction, binaural beats may improve attention, memory, and creativity, helping individuals manage mental fatigue caused by daily stressors.

How to Use Binaural Beats Effectively

To maximize the benefits of binaural beats, consider these practical tips:

  1. Choose the Right Frequency:
    • Delta (0.5–4 Hz): Deep sleep and restorative relaxation
    • Theta (4–8 Hz): Meditation, stress relief, creativity
    • Alpha (8–14 Hz): Calmness, light relaxation, focus
  2. Use Stereo Headphones: Binaural beats require separate frequencies in each ear, so high-quality stereo headphones are essential.
  3. Create a Comfortable Environment: Find a quiet space, free of distractions, to enhance the effectiveness of the session.
  4. Consistency Matters: Daily practice, even for 10–20 minutes, can yield noticeable benefits over time.
  5. Combine With Other Relaxation Techniques: Pairing binaural beats with breathing exercises, mindfulness, or gentle stretches amplifies the stress-relief effect.

Potential Limitations

While binaural beats are promising, it’s important to consider limitations:

  • Individual Variability: Not everyone responds to binaural beats in the same way; some may notice profound relaxation, while others may experience minimal effects.
  • Not a Standalone Treatment: Binaural beats should complement, not replace, evidence-based therapies for anxiety, depression, or chronic stress.
  • Overstimulation Risk: Listening at high volumes for extended periods can cause discomfort or headaches, so moderate use is recommended.
